随着互联网的飞速发展,视频内容审核成为了网络安全和舆论监管的重要环节。近年来,深度学习技术在视频内容审核领域取得了显著成果,其中DeepFlow算法作为一种高效的视频内容审核方法,备受关注。本文将从DeepFlow算法的原理、优势及在实际应用中的挑战等方面进行探讨。

一、DeepFlow算法原理

DeepFlow算法是一种基于深度学习的视频内容审核方法,其主要思想是利用深度神经网络提取视频帧之间的时空特征,进而实现对视频内容的智能审核。具体来说,DeepFlow算法主要包括以下几个步骤:

  1. 特征提取:首先,利用卷积神经网络(CNN)对视频帧进行特征提取,得到每个帧的特征图。

  2. 时空特征融合:将相邻帧的特征图进行时空特征融合,得到时空特征图。

  3. 损失函数设计:设计损失函数,用于衡量时空特征图与真实标签之间的差异。

  4. 训练与优化:通过反向传播算法对深度神经网络进行训练和优化,提高模型在视频内容审核方面的性能。

二、DeepFlow算法优势

  1. 高效性:DeepFlow算法采用深度神经网络进行特征提取和时空特征融合,能够快速处理大量视频数据,提高审核效率。

  2. 准确性:通过深度学习技术,DeepFlow算法能够自动提取视频帧之间的时空特征,实现对视频内容的精准审核。

  3. 可扩展性:DeepFlow算法可以针对不同类型的视频内容进行定制化训练,具有较强的可扩展性。

  4. 鲁棒性:DeepFlow算法在处理复杂场景和光照变化等情况下,仍能保持较高的审核准确率。

三、DeepFlow算法在实际应用中的挑战

  1. 数据标注:DeepFlow算法的训练需要大量标注数据,数据标注的准确性和完整性对算法性能有较大影响。

  2. 计算资源:DeepFlow算法在训练和推理过程中需要消耗大量计算资源,对硬件设备要求较高。

  3. 模型泛化能力:在实际应用中,DeepFlow算法需要面对各种复杂场景和光照变化,提高模型的泛化能力是关键。

  4. 跨域适应性:DeepFlow算法在特定领域或场景下可能存在性能瓶颈,提高算法的跨域适应性是未来研究方向。

四、总结

DeepFlow算法作为一种基于深度学习的视频内容审核方法,在提高审核效率和准确性方面具有显著优势。然而,在实际应用中仍面临诸多挑战。未来,研究人员应从数据标注、计算资源、模型泛化能力和跨域适应性等方面入手,不断提升DeepFlow算法的性能,为视频内容审核领域提供更加高效、精准的解决方案。

猜你喜欢:全景性能监控